If he's at the rumored 5 year / $100 MM deal, it sounds about right for getting him at a covid discount. Really can't complain at all. I'd prefer that money spent on a non-outfielder, but the term and dollar value are solid compared to salaries for stars in a normal year. So in a weird way it seems like a deal. Although I'd prefer Realmuto, if they go the direction of Springer, with the need to upgrade pitching, perhaps you save the money for next year to sign an Ace, and rely on the existing catching prospects to pan out. I'm not opposed to that in any way. Dealing Grichek and a prospect 10th ranked prospect should bring back a #3 starter. Things are looking up.
